Output e6ecfda320f8fbb9b22f270479664e9b5a4c1a0f4b4f742e28bcce76b793e170:29

value
2083116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a86a73c0849f62ae2b6a9ea4571b5b0f53b671 OP_EQUAL
address
MVqeACvdc621HWM9iAQGrLJe5rdwSVnLkh
transaction
e6ecfda320f8fbb9b22f270479664e9b5a4c1a0f4b4f742e28bcce76b793e170
spent
true